If possible, I suggest not doing transfers from NTSC-PAL and vice versa. I use DVD studio pro (on Mac) and version 1.5 can combine both NTSC and PAL clips in the same project (Versions 2 and 3 can't do that for some reason). Of course TV capable of reproducing both systems would be needed.

Regarding AFI documentaries... There is no reference of one for Ridley Scott being made. The one with Cameron did feature some aliens EPK footage, but all of it in its entirety was released on The Alien saga DVD

AVP was pretty decent considering low budget and lack of involvement from RS & JC. In a recent interview even Cameron himself placed it as 3rd best alien movie ever (probably after Alien & Aliens. He hated Alien 3... I wonder if he got to watch the new cut, which improves it significantelly making it look more like Fincher we got to know)

Alien War had great props. One Colonial Marine told me they had exact replicas for Pulse rifles but they were falling apart due to wear and tear, so they had to replace them with more robust models. Ash595, contact me so we can arrange exchange of materials. By the way, HRT stands for Hrvatska Radio TV (Croatian national TV) and it denotes previews it featured in various film shows.
I've been on "alien war in London" several times and it really is the most realistic film attraction ever made. You run & sweat with colonial marines, people get snatched by aliens and quite real sence of thril land fear is generated. After I got used to it I scared some girl improvising a facehugger on her shoulder, grabbed my friend for a foot and provoked a reflexive slapp on my face... I've heard about (real) US marines picking a fight during attraction with (fake) colonial marines and people throwing up afterwards. Too bad it closed. I've heard the place flooded and insurance money was good and basicaly no need to reopen it, They should have open one in Japan.
On the other hand "Ride at the speed of fright" in San Francisco is cheeesy simulator ride (with even cheesier acting), but it does feature aliens style cinematography (in IMAX format) and sets.
